# Break-Glass: Catalog Cache Invalidation

Scope: the Pinrow product catalog at Veldstone Retail. If stale prices persist after a purge and the Hollowmere invalidation queue is wedged, use break-glass to flush the edge tier directly. Contractors: get verbal sign-off from the catalog lead first. Steps: open the Hollowmere admin shell, select emergency-flush, confirm the tenant, and run it once — repeated flushes thrash the origin. Access is logged and expires after 20 minutes. Unseal the admin shell with the passphrase below.

recovery phrase for kahop-tajog: istix-casvan

Routes Quillbird deep links through a single validated dispatcher. Removes per-screen URL parsing; all links now pass scheme/host allowlist checks before intent resolution. Unrecognized paths fall back to the home screen, never to a WebView. Added replay protection: signed link tokens expire and are single-use. Security notes: no user input reaches the route table; path params are typed and length-capped. Tests cover malformed hosts, mixed-case schemes, and token reuse. Token lifetime and rate caps are tunable; current values follow.

tuning constants:
QUOTAS = {
    "quenael": 10,
    "oliwyn": 1,
}

## Ownership

The orphaned-resource sweeper (codename Tidewrack) runs nightly against the Pellick staging and production accounts. It flags volumes, snapshots, and load balancers with no owning tag, then deletes them after a 72-hour grace window. Contractors should never modify the exclusion list without sign-off. Config lives in the `sweeper-policy` repo. All questions, exceptions, and deletion disputes go to the service owner listed below.

account owner for bawip-tahag: Raleth Quenok